Quick Summary / Abstract
Approve the provider agreement between Early Learning Coalition (ELC) of Broward County, Florida and The School Board of Broward County (SBBC) to implement the 2014-2015 Voluntary Pre-Kindergarten (VPK) Education Program.

SBBC agrees to implement the VPK Program throughout the District for School Year 2014-2015 and Summer 2015.  The term of this agreement will begin August 19, 2014 through August 18, 2015.  Some schools will provide a VPK/Extended Day Option for students enrolled in Head Start classrooms and other eligible 4-year-olds. The Extended Day Option consists of an additional three (3) hours of instruction beyond the regular school day.  In addition, some schools will provide a VPK program model that combine (3) hours of free, VPK with the option of fee-based, enrichment hours.  Other models include full-day Pre-K classes that utilize VPK funding in combination with either Title I or ESE funding.  A 300-hour summer VPK program for any eligible 4-year-old will also be provided.

This provider agreement has been reviewed and approved as to form and legal content by the Office of the General Counsel.  The ELC will sign this agreement following the School Board approval.

The positive financial impact to the District is  $2,064,874.40.  The source of funds is the ELC.  There is no additional financial impact to the District.
